Biden admits bad debate, but promises to recover. “When we are knocked down, we get back up”

After a questionable performance in Thursday’s debatewhich led many experts to doubt the fitness of the President of the United States, Joe Biden admitted that his performance was not good, but that he knows how to “tell the truth†.

At a rally held this Friday in Raleigh, North Carolina, Biden commented for the first time on the confrontation with Donald Trump, which was marked by the President’s vocal problems and difficulties in completing their thoughts and sentences.

“You know I’m not a young man, to state the obvious. You know I don’t walk as easily as I used to, I don’t speak as softly as I used to. I don’t debate it like I used to, but you know I tell the truth,’ he said, quoted by The Guardian. And, using his usual close tone with several idiomatic expressions, he said: “When we are knocked down, we get back up again†.

In a much more effusive and energetic speech, and accompanied by a noisy audience, Joe Biden highlighted that he knows how to distinguish “what is right from what is wrong†and that he remains prepared to assume a second term as President – if he wins After the elections, his Presidency would last until he was 86 years old.

“Friends, I give you my word as a Biden. I wouldn’t run if I didn’t believe, with all my heart, that I was capable of doing this job. Because, frankly, there is too much at stake,” he pointed out.

The President appeared accompanied by his wife and teacher Jill Biden, having been introduced on stage by another teacher in the area. The end of the speech ended, symbolically, with Biden walking away from the pulpit while the song “I won’t back down†(“I won’t give upâ€), by Tom Petty, played.

The moment also served to attack Donald Trump, both for his criminal record and for the way he was in the debate. Trump, who is once again a candidate for the White House after fully assuming the reins of the Republican Party, spent the debate making false statements, particularly on issues of abortion, the state of the economy and his time as President , between 2017 and 2021.

“He lied about the great economy he created. She lied about the pandemic that she sabotaged, killing millions of people. She closed businesses, schools, people lost their homes across the country. America was on its knees,†she argued.

The crowd in Raleigh, resurrecting a chant created by Trump supporters to attack Hillary Clinton in 2016, shouted “Lock him up” after Biden considered the former North leader -American as “a one-man crime wave†.

Unlike Hillary Clinton, however, Trump was found guilty of 34 crimes, as part of his extramarital affair with pornographic actress Stormy Daniels. Trump is also being investigated in three other criminal cases, and has already reached a compensation agreement with author E. Jean Carroll following an accusation of sexual assault. “The only criminal on stage last night was Donald Trump,†Biden concluded.

The North American elections are scheduled for November 5th. Until then, a new debate is scheduled for September 10th between Democrat Joe Biden and Republican Donald Trump, who at that point will already be officially chosen by their parties.
